Akamai Announces App & API Protector Hybrid for Expanded WAF Defense

Hybrid solution delivers consistent security for applications and APIs deployed in multi-cloud, on-premises, and CDN-agnostic infrastructures

Written By : Analytics Insight

Akamai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: AKAM), the cybersecurity and cloud computing company that powers and protects business online, today introduced App & API Protector Hybrid. Users can now expand the critical Web Application Firewall (WAF) capabilities of Akamai’s Web Application and API Protection (WAAP) while consistently securing applications and APIs for multi-cloud, on-premises, and CDN-agnostic environments.

Engineered to deliver enhanced protection,  Akamai’s Web Application and API Protection Hybrid safeguards applications, APIs, microservices and workloads against a range of sophisticated threats while delivering resilience, scalability, and simplified security management. The launch furthers Akamai’s vision of enabling organizations to secure their applications, data, and APIs consistently—across every environment.

Akamai Technologies, Inc.’s App & API Protector Hybrid extends Akamai’s leading WAAP security with the ability to defend distributed applications, APIs and microservices,” said Rupesh Chokshi, Senior Vice President and General Manager, Application Security, Akamai. “As customer ecosystems are increasingly spread across on-premises, multi-cloud, and on-and-off-CDN environments, this solution simplifies security for modern organizations.”
